About Enid Woodring Regional

Enid, Oklahoma's KWDG (Enid Woodring Regional) is a publicly owned, towered airport. 2 runways serve the field. Runway 17/35 reaches 8,613 by 100 feet of concrete, the longer option. Runway 13/31 measures 3,150 by 75 feet of concrete. 7 published approaches include ILS/LOC, RNAV (GPS), and VOR. Controlled traffic works tower 118.9 MHz, ground 121.925 MHz, and approach 121.3 MHz. Fuel available: 100LL avgas and Jet A with additive. Aviators Wing Pilot Center and Aero Club of Enid operate here. The airport sits at 1,167 feet above mean sea level.
